Melodic sequencer
BeatStep Pro features two melodic step sequencers. Record the pitch, duration and velocity of a note in real time using the pads or an external keyboard and your sequence will play back, quantized at the step resolution. You can also enter notes in step mode using the knobs and Step buttons.
Sequences can have up to 64 steps, with a total of 32 sequences per Project and 16 Projects in all.
Drum sequencer
In addition to the two melodic sequencers, BeatStep Pro features a 16-track drum sequencer. As with the others, these sequences can be recorded in real time using the pads. But you can also enter the steps using a classic drum machine workflow; the choice is yours.
The knobs can be used to define the velocity and duration of notes, and they’re also able to shift the timing of the notes away from the quantized values. That way your patterns will have exactly the kind of groove you want.
MIDI Controller
Knobs, buttons, and pads: BeatStep Pro has quite a few. And they’re fully customizable using the included MIDI Control Center application. Use BeatStep Pro to make your MIDI devices and VST instruments do exactly what you want them to.
FEATURES
- 2 monophonic step sequencers
- Up to 64 steps per sequence
- Note, velocity and gate time settings per step
- Note tie
- 16-track drum sequencer (one track per pad)
- MIDI controller mode
- Fully customizable for knobs, step buttons and velocity and pressure sensitive pads
- Send MIDI CC, note data, program changes
- 16 Projects, each with 16×2 sequences, 16 drum sequences and a controller map.
- Performance controls
- Randomizer with Amount and Probability settings
- Real-time looper/roller touch strip
- Independent swing amount per sequence
- Touch sensitive knobs
- Tap Tempo
- Connectivity
- CV/GATE outputs (1 volt per octave CV, 10 volt gates)
- 8 drum gate outputs
- Clock sync with multiple standards
- MIDI In/Out with supplied MIDI adaptors
- USB class compliant
- Supports full parameter and sequencing editing capability using our free MIDI Control Center software
- Kensington lock
